Used Left and Right exterior door handles with driver quality chrome. They have pitting and overspray on them. The buttons are included. You will need the latch mechanism and the button springs to complete and fastening nuts. Removed from a '69 Torino. These are for the drivers and passenger doors. They fit torino, fairlane, montego, mustang and cougar for 69-70 years.

Audi are running an RS5 at the Pikes Peak Hillclimb event in Colorado and taking the opportunity to showcase Ducati with a competition. The Pikes Peak International Hillclimb is a 12 mile hillclimb event held in the Pikes Peak Mountain Range in Colorado, with 156 turns and a climb to 4,720 feet. A test of any car (or motorbike).

CAR Online reader greamedykes submits his brief report on the 2010 European Motor Show Brussels. The 88th European Motor Show Brussels took place at the Brussels Expo between the 14th and 24th of January. During this period, 606,000 visitors viewed the latest offerings from the car industry.

Audi has challenged six international architects to present their vision for a future urban landscape that will explore the interplay between mobility, architecture and the city. The winner of the Audi Urban Future Awards will receive a €100,000 prize to be presented at the Venice Biennale in August. Phase one has been completed, with the contestants presenting their hypothesis for the city of the future at the Royal Institute of British Architects in London in May.
